Ingredients
Green Beans
- 1 pound Fresh green beans, ends trimmed
- 1 recipe "Pinot Grigio Vinaigrette"
- To taste Salt and pepper (optional)
Pinot Grigio Vingaigrette
- 2 tbsp Pinot Grigio wine vinegar
- 1 tbsp Dijon mustard
- 1/2 tbsp Honey
- 1 tbsp Extra virgin olive oil
- 1 tbsp Minced shallots
- 1 tsp Minced fresh garlic
- 2 tbsp Finely chopped fresh flat-leaf parsley leaves
- To taste Salt
- To taste Black pepper
Green Beans with Pinot Grigio Vinaigrette

Directions
4 SERVINGS
Green Beans
- Place a steamer insert in a Circulon Contempo 3 qt Covered Saucepan. Fill the pot with water so it reaches just below the steamer rack. Place the pot over high heat and bring the water to a boil. Add the green beans and cover the pot. Cook them until crisp tender, about 4-6 minutes.
- Remove the green beans to a large glass or plastic bowl, making sure to drain any excess moisture from the beans. Gently toss the green beans with the vinaigrette until they are completely coated.
- Transer the beans to a serving platter or divide among 4 plates. Serve immediately. Season with additional salt and pepper, if desired.
5 TABLESPOONS
Pinot Grigio Vinaigrette
- In a small bowl, whisk together the vinegar, mustard and honey. Slowly whisk in the olive oil. Stir in the shallots, garlic, and parsley until well combined. Season with salt and pepper. Dressing can be made up to 5 days in advance.
